ctdrumrunr - 2018-11-25 1:36 PM I went to one many years ago and would never go to another. SHe did not ride the horses, was pushing her dentist and chiropracter and favored the group that had mostly rodeo girls in it.  The ladies she had working with us lesser barrel racers were nice but I didn't pay to have them teach me. Day 1 we were outside with helpers and rodeo girls inside with CJ, day 2 we were all inside with CJ and she was helping them a lot and casually watching the rest of us.

Not worth the money, I would do a Paul Humphrey clinic if there is one near you.
